Max B Walks Free After Serving Almost 16 Years In Prison

Billboard reports that Max B walked out of Northern State Prison in Newark, New Jersey on Sunday, Nov. 9 after serving nearly 16 years behind bars. TMZ adds that he was originally sentenced to 75 years for his alleged role in a deadly New Jersey hotel robbery, but in 2016 it was reduced to 20 years after he pleaded guilty to aggravated manslaughter.

Earlier this year, Max teased his release while calling into ‘The Joe Budden Podcast.’ At the time, he told the hosts he was feeling great and “righteous,” per Complex“I’m doing all right. This is almost over. Wavy Baby coming home real soon.” He also said he was hyped about getting back to work.

“We on divine time. I’m working. I can’t wait to get re-acclimated. You already know I’m a musical genius myself, so n****s gotta get re-acclimated with my s**t. It’s a challenge. I love a good challenge. I’m the trendsetter!” Max B added.

French Montana & Max Reunite

Fans weren’t the only ones hyped about Max B’s release. His longtime friend French Montana was too. On Sunday, French posted a video on Instagram of their long-awaited reunion and shared he felt overjoyed to have his brother back just in time for his 41st birthday, also on Nov. 9.

“CANT MAKE THIS UP ! MY BROTHER REALLY CAME HOME ON MY B DAY ! HAMDULILLAH WALKED IT DOWN ! NO MORE FREE YOU,” French captioned his post.
